Role Overview

As an OT, you will support students in school settings by assessing their needs, developing individualized plans, and implementing interventions to help them succeed academically, socially, and physically. This role offers the opportunity to work with young learners in a supportive school environment while making a lasting impact on their development.

Key Responsibilities
  • Assess students  motor, sensory, and functional abilities to identify areas of need and develop individualized therapy plans.
  • Deliver targeted occupational therapy interventions in accordance with students  IEPs, helping them achieve academic and developmental goals.
  • Work closely with teachers, administrators, and other specialists to create supportive learning environments tailored to students  unique needs.
  • Contribute to the development of IEPs by offering insights on motor development, sensory needs, and appropriate accommodation or modifications.
